Fujitsu MB90895 Series Hardware Manual page 67

16 bit, controller manual
Table of Contents

Advertisement

I Register Bank
The register bank can be used as a general-purpose register (byte registers R0 to R7, word registers RW0 to
RW7, and long-word registers RL0 to RL3) to perform various operations or to serve as a pointer. The
long- word register can also be used as a linear addressing to directly access the entire memory space.
In the same way as ordinary RAM, the value in the general-purpose register is unchanged by a reset,
meaning that the state before the reset is held. However, at power-on, the value is undefined.
Table 3.3-1 shows the typical functions of the general- purpose register.
Table 3.3-1 Typical Functions of the General-purpose Register
Register Name
R0 to R7
RW0 to RW7
RL0 to RL3
Used as operands for various instructions
Note:
R0 can also be used as the barrel shift counter or the normalized instruction counter.
Used as addressing
Used as operands for various instructions
Note:
RW0 can also be used as the string instruction counter.
Used as linear addressing
Used as operands for various instructions
Function
CHAPTER 3 CPU
49

Advertisement

Table of Contents
loading

This manual is also suitable for:

F2mc-16lx

Table of Contents